I believe you have to program a mailbox for the operator's extension.
I think someone entered vm programming and changed the extension. You can verify with the mem software or via the admin box.
Yes, the mailbox 0 was changed to 9404xxxxxxx, I deleted and input a 0, tested fine. The funny thing now, is I cannot change the passord to mailbox 9999? It denies me? NOW WHAT! If it aint one thing its another?
Were the passwords default? Sounds like someone was highjacking VM for outbound calls. If you aren't doing external notification I would block the voicemail from accessing external lines.

Try logging into the "Tech" mailbox and changing the admin passcode from there.
I went to the site, listed out all mailboxes, I did not see a "Tech Mailbox". I am not a master of any systems, but am able to work on a bunch of them, so your help, as always, is greatly appreciated on assisting me on resteeing the password on mailbox 9999....
When you log into mailbox 9999 there is a Tech/Installer passcode and there is an Administrators passcode and it depends on which code you use as to what options you have access to.

If the default admin password has been changed and you can't get in, there aren't many options.
You could contact Mitel and see if they can get into it and reset the password. You could buy a hard drive with the express messenger software on it and swap the disc and reprogram. I'm not sure which file on the disc contains the password, but maybe someone knows and can get you the default file.
What version of software is the Express Messenger running. If it is an old version the passwords were different.
Silly questions:
1. Are you deinitely using 4 digit mailbox numbers? So, the admin box is definitely 9999?
There is a system option that sets length of passwords.
If it's NOT 4, you have to preface the default admin password with 0's, so you have the proper number of digits in your password length.
